Dedicates a portion of state route 63 in Dansville, Livingston County, to Clara H. Barton.

New York A10792 amends the highway law to dedicate a specific segment of state route 63 in the village of Dansville, Livingston County, to Clara H. Barton. The dedicated portion runs from the intersection with Zerfass State to its intersection with Hubbard Lane. The commissioner of transportation is tasked with installing and maintaining appropriate signage indicating the dedication, which will state "Highway Dedicated to Clara H. Barton." The dedication is ceremonial, and the official name of the highway will not change. The act takes effect immediately.
